The recommended formats for BIM models are (*.RVT) and (*.NWD) files, the table below explains the differences between them.
Format | Revit (*.RVT) | Navisworks (*.NWD) | Other Fromats |
Can be imported | Yes | Yes | Yes |
Can be linked to schedules | Yes | Yes | Yes |
Can be updated while maintaining the link with schedule | Yes (robust) | Yes (not stable) | No |
Can be aligned inside Reconstruct | No | No | No |
Reconstruct also can import Synchro models if they are exported to (*.IFC) format. If you have a Synchro model, you can export it to (*.IFC) and upload it to Reconstruct. In this case, Reconstruct can read all the components of that model, including BIM, Schedule, and the link between them.
In addition to the aforementioned formats, Reconstruct supports importing all the following BIM formats:
- 3DM
- 3DS
- A
- ASM
- BRD
- CATPART
- CATPRODUCT
- CGR
- COLLABORATION
- DAE
- DGN
- DLV3
- DWF
- DWFX
- DWG
- DWT
- DXF
- EMODE
- EXP
- F2D
- F3D
- FBX
- G
- GBXML
- GLB
- GLTF
- IAM
- IDW
- IFC
- IGE
- IGES
- IGS
- IPT
- IWM
- JT
- MAX
- MODEL
- MPF
- MSR
- NEU
- NWC
- NWD
- OBJ
- PMLPRJ
- PMLPRJZ
- PRT
- PSMODEL
- RCP
- RVT
- SAB
- SAT
- SCH
- SESSION
- SKP
- SLDASM
- SLDPRT
- STE
- STEP
- STL
- STLA
- STLB
- STP
- STPZ
- VUE
- WIRE
- X_B
- X_T
- XAS
- XPR
- ZIP
